Brunswick County Man arrested on drug charges

WILMINGTON, NC (WWAY) — A man has been arrested after allegedly being found with more than 20 grams of cocaine.
According to the Wilmington Police Department, units conducted a traffic stop on a vehicle on the Martin Luther King Jr. Parkway.
A vehicle search led to the discovery of more than 20 grams of crack cocaine.
Derreon James, 31, of Navassa has been charged with PWISD Cocaine, Felony Possession Schedule II Controlled Substance, Possession of Drug Paraphernalia, and Carrying Concealed Weapon-Gun.
He is currently being held at the NHSO Detention Center with a $100,000 secured bond.
